The median household income in Mullin, TX is $45,250, which is 38.2% below the national average of $73,224. Per capita income is $19,695. The poverty rate of 17.8% is higher than the TX state average of 14.9%. The Gini index of income inequality is 0.3080, where 0 represents perfect equality and 1 represents maximum inequality. The unemployment rate is 6.4%, compared to the state average of 5.1%. 1.1%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her.
